Bush pruning services involve carefully trimming and shaping shrubs and bushes to maintain their health, appearance, and safety. This process typically includes removing dead or diseased branches, thinning out overgrown areas, and shaping the plants to fit the desired aesthetic or functional purpose. Proper pruning encourages healthy growth, prevents branches from becoming weak or broken, and helps keep the landscape looking neat and well-maintained. Local contractors experienced in bush pruning can assess the specific needs of different types of bushes and perform the work efficiently to enhance the overall look of a property.
These services help address common problems such as overgrown or unruly bushes that can obstruct pathways, windows, or views. Overgrown shrubs can also harbor pests or become susceptible to disease if not properly maintained. Additionally, poorly shaped or neglected bushes can detract from the curb appeal of a property. Regular pruning helps prevent these issues by promoting healthy growth patterns and reducing the risk of damage caused by heavy branches or disease. The overview below groups typical Bush Pruning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Claremont,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Tree Trimming - typical costs range from $150-$400 for routine pruning of small trees and bushes. Many local contractors handle these projects within this range, which covers most standard maintenance jobs. Larger or more intricate trims may push costs higher but are less common in routine work.
Medium Tree Pruning - projects of moderate size usually fall between $400-$1,200. Many homeowners in Claremont opt for this service to maintain healthy, well-shaped trees, with most jobs staying within this band. More complex or larger trees can increase the price significantly.
Large Tree Pruning - extensive pruning of mature or tall trees can cost from $1,200-$3,500 or more. This range is typical for larger projects, while fewer jobs reach the highest end, which involves complex equipment or safety measures. Local pros often provide custom quotes for these larger jobs.
Full Tree Removal - removing a tree entirely generally costs between $500-$3,000, depending on size, location, and complexity. Many projects are completed within the middle of this range, but very large or hard-to-access trees can push costs higher, requiring specialized equipment and labor.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
